as i said it's hate here, and i might be wrong but consider the following :
for($icount=0;$icount<11;$icount++)
{
$iPid = pcntl_fork();
$iChildrenCount = 0;
if ($iPid == 0)
{
// child
echo ("child $icount\n");
}
else
{
// parrent
}
}
this is essential what you do in your example? If so, this code does not
start 10 children. It starts more.

>> This would start more than 10 children. Children will continue on with for
>> loop after they do their work. As you advice that the children have an
>> exit,
>> i assume that you just overlooked it while writing this example. Also, a
>> wait on the children, at some point, gets rid of the zombies, as i see
>> from
>> your code, there is no way you won't have zombie processes, unless the
>> parent exists, and then the zombies also disappear.
